#e79485 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e79485 is composed of 90.6% red, 58%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.9%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 9.2 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 71.4%. #e79485 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cf290b.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#e79485 color description : Very soft red.

#e79485 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e79485 has RGB values of R:231, G:148,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.42,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15176837.

Shades and Tints of #e79485

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090302 is the darkest color, while #fef9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e79485

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ab3b2 is the less saturated color, while #fd846f is the most saturated one.
